STAMPING YOUR MEMORIES WITH BEAUTIFUL AND MINIMALIST GIFT IDEAS
Carly Scott, owner and creative genius behind Love, Pieces of Eight has been providing beautiful gift ideas since 2014. We have had the pleasure to talk to Carly about her journey as a business owner and where she sees the path taking her next. Carly set up Love, Pieces of Eight after receiving some great feedback from gifts she made for her loved ones. She had loads of friends asking her to create them something special and as a result, her business was born.
Starting out with an Etsy shop, Carly set about creating a space in her home to make her stunning gifts. She works from her home workshop where she has been gathering tools and teaching herself techniques to create beautiful, unique gifts for any occasion. At first, this creative outlet was just meant to be a hobby for Carly, but over time it has developed in to a well-loved business in which her designs are great quality, whilst also remaining affordable. She began by creating hand stamped pieces, jewellery and vintage cutlery and from there, her Etsy shop grew!

Growing up in Rugby, Carly set up her business and has felt tremendous support from the community of creatives around her. Whilst she runs the business on her own and creates all the products she sells; Carly is supported by her partner Daniel who makes her cups of tea and gives her a helping hand when things get busy. And of course, most importantly, she is kept company by her two dogs, Coco and Beres who make sure her days are never dull!
